Understanding Cloud-Based CMMS: A Modern Approach to Maintenance
Cloud-Based CMMS, also known as Software as a Service (SaaS) CMMS, leverages the power of the internet to provide a centralized platform for managing all aspects of maintenance operations. Unlike traditional, on-premise software, data is stored on secure servers maintained by the software vendor, accessible from any device with an internet connection. This eliminates the need for expensive hardware investments, IT maintenance, and complex installations, offering a more flexible and scalable solution.
Key Features and Functionality of Cloud-Based CMMS
A robust Cloud-Based CMMS offers a comprehensive suite of features designed to streamline maintenance processes and improve asset performance. Key functionalities often include:
- Work Order Management: Creating, assigning, tracking, and closing work orders efficiently. This includes defining priority levels, attaching relevant documents, and scheduling maintenance tasks.
- Preventive Maintenance (PM) Scheduling: Automating the scheduling of routine maintenance tasks based on time, meter readings, or other pre-defined criteria. This proactive approach helps prevent equipment failures and extend asset lifespans.
- Asset Management: Maintaining a comprehensive database of assets, including details such as location, specifications, warranty information, and maintenance history.
- Inventory Management: Tracking spare parts, supplies, and tools, managing inventory levels, and automating reorder processes to ensure sufficient availability.
- Reporting and Analytics: Generating customizable reports and dashboards to track key performance indicators (KPIs) such as Mean Time Between Failures (MTBF), Mean Time To Repair (MTTR), and overall maintenance costs. This data-driven approach allows for informed decision-making and continuous improvement.
- Mobile Accessibility: Accessing the CMMS system from mobile devices (smartphones, tablets) to allow technicians to receive work orders, update asset information, and track progress in real-time.
- Integration Capabilities: Integrating with other business systems, such as Enterprise Resource Planning (ERP) and Building Management Systems (BMS), to create a unified data flow and improve operational efficiency.
Benefits of Implementing Cloud-Based CMMS
The adoption of Cloud-Based CMMS offers a multitude of benefits for organizations across various sectors:
- Reduced Costs: Lower upfront investment compared to on-premise solutions. Reduced IT support requirements, streamlined operations, and optimized resource allocation contribute to significant cost savings.
- Improved Efficiency: Automation of manual tasks, streamlined work order management, and faster access to information lead to significant improvements in operational efficiency.
- Enhanced Asset Uptime: Proactive preventive maintenance scheduling minimizes downtime and extends the lifespan of assets, leading to increased productivity and profitability.
- Increased Compliance: Centralized data storage and audit trails facilitate compliance with industry regulations and standards.
- Better Data Analysis: Comprehensive reporting and analytics provide valuable insights into maintenance performance, allowing for data-driven decision-making and continuous improvement.
- Improved Communication and Collaboration: Real-time access to information and mobile accessibility enhance communication and collaboration between maintenance teams, technicians, and other stakeholders.
- Scalability and Flexibility: Cloud-based solutions are easily scalable to accommodate changing business needs. They are also flexible and can be customized to fit specific requirements.
- Enhanced Security: Cloud providers invest heavily in security measures to protect data, often exceeding the capabilities of individual organizations. Regular backups and disaster recovery plans ensure data protection.
Selecting the Right Cloud-Based CMMS for Your Business
Choosing the right Cloud-Based CMMS is a crucial step in ensuring a successful implementation. Consider the following factors when evaluating different solutions:
- Functionality and Features: Ensure the CMMS offers all the features required to meet your specific maintenance needs.
- Ease of Use: The system should be user-friendly and intuitive, with a minimal learning curve for your technicians.
- Scalability: The CMMS should be able to scale to accommodate your future growth.
- Integration Capabilities: Verify that the CMMS integrates seamlessly with your existing systems.
- Mobile Accessibility: Mobile functionality is essential for technicians working in the field.
- Pricing and Support: Evaluate the pricing model and the level of support offered by the vendor.
- Security and Reliability: Prioritize vendors with robust security measures and a proven track record of reliability.
- Vendor Reputation: Research the vendor’s reputation and read reviews from other users.
- Implementation Support: Consider the level of support the vendor provides during the implementation process, including training and data migration assistance.

The Future of Maintenance Management: Cloud is the Catalyst
The adoption of Cloud-Based CMMS is not merely a trend; it’s a fundamental shift in how businesses approach maintenance. As technology continues to evolve, we can expect to see further advancements in areas such as:
- Artificial Intelligence (AI) and Machine Learning (ML): Used for predictive maintenance, anomaly detection, and automated task scheduling.
- Internet of Things (IoT): Integration of sensors to monitor equipment performance in real-time and provide data for predictive maintenance.
- Augmented Reality (AR): For providing technicians with interactive work instructions and remote assistance.
